Here is information about the film about the Postville immigration raid I mentioned today on the show.


*Mr. Mejia will be joined by critically acclaimed movie director Luis Argueta who is in the post-production stage of abUSed - The Postville Raid, the full-length documentary that tells the story of the most brutal, most expensive, and one of the largest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E) raids in the history of the United States. Most of these workers were from Guatemala. The film presents the human face of the issue of immigration reform and serves as a cautionary tale against abuses of constitutional human rights. Mr. Argueta’s visit to Madison is being coordinated by Interfaith Coalition for Worker Justice in cooperation with the Workers Rights Center.
